How much does it cost to rent a home in Rowlett?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Rowlett 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,213 | $1,250 | $2,700 |
| Rowlett 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,458 | $737 | $8,821 |
| Rowlett 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,833 | $1,850 | $6,200 |
| Rowlett 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,022 | $2,000 | $3,990 |
| Rowlett 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,349 | $3,349 | $3,349 |
| Rowlett 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,000 | $4,000 | $4,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Rowlett
What type of rentals are currently available in Rowlett?
There are currently 90 Apartments for Rent in Rowlett, TX with pricing that ranges from $744 to $19,182. There are also 400 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Rowlett ranging from $470 to $8,821.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Rowlett?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Rowlett ranges from $470 to $8,821 with an average monthly rent of $2,803.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Rowlett?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Rowlett range from $1,395 to $4,866,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$737 to $8,821.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,850 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,287.
